Job overview

An opportunity has arisen for a motivated, enthusiastic and highly skilled nurse to join the dynamic and progressive Specialist Palliative Care Team working in the London Borough of Redbridge for NELFT. The post is Full time 37.5 hrs per week 09.00 - 17.00 pm working flexibly across the 7-day service and is a substantive position. We are seeking a dynamic nurse, who can demonstrate excellent communication skills and have a passion for delivering the highest quality holistic palliative and end of life care to patients and their families.

This post presents an exciting opportunity to individuals to influence and enhance the provision of high quality care that patients and families deserve at end of life, within Redbridge,

The specialist palliative care clinical nurse specialist will be a key team member in the delivery of specialist palliative nursing services to enable and support timely and effective care and assessment and intervention for patients with specialist palliative care needs in the community settings.

Main duties of the job

They will, as part of the specialist palliative care service, enhance the specialist nursing service undertaking the assessment and triage of patients, ensuring patients and carers receive high quality care, support and advice.

The post holder will provide advice and support to other members of the multi-professional teams involved in the care of patients with specialist palliative care needs.

There is opportunity for professional development and specialist training in palliative care, including Independent Prescribing, which is beneficial in streamlining patient care interventions.
